    This study reveals that larger genes in higher eukaryotes correlate with larger intergenic DNA regions. These extragenic DNA sequences likely maintain essential gene functions.

    Area of Science:

    • Genetics
    • Molecular Biology
    • Eukaryotic Gene Regulation

    Background:

    • Gene clusters are fundamental to higher eukaryotic genome organization.
    • The role of non-functional DNA sequences in gene spatial arrangement is not fully understood.

    Purpose of the Study:

    • To investigate the relationship between gene size and the size of surrounding extragenic DNA sequences in clustered gene families.
    • To determine if non-functional DNA plays a role in the spatial arrangement and function of genes.

    Main Methods:

    • Comparative analysis of extragenic DNA sequence sizes in various clustered gene families.
    • Measurement of intergenic region sizes in paired genes within these families.

    Main Results:

  • A positive correlation was observed between the size of paired genes and the size of their flanking intergenic regions.
  • This gene size-dependent increase in intergenic region size was not observed for genes smaller than 0.3 kb or larger than 4 kb.
  • Conclusions:

    • Higher eukaryotic genes appear to require surrounding extragenic DNA sequences.
    • These DNA territories are hypothesized to be crucial for maintaining active gene functions.
